在计算机操作中,有时候我们需要读取文件中的特定位置的数据,比如读取某个文件的第二行第二列的字符。在Windows系统中,我们可以使用CMD(命令提示符)来完成这个任务。下面,我将详细讲解如何使用CMD读取文件特定位置的字符。
步骤一:打开CMD
首先,我们需要打开CMD。在Windows系统中,可以通过以下几种方式打开CMD:
- 按下
Win + R键,输入cmd并回车。 - 在开始菜单中搜索“命令提示符”,并打开。
- 在任务栏的搜索框中输入
cmd并打开。
步骤二:定位到文件所在目录
在CMD中,我们需要先定位到要读取的文件所在的目录。可以使用cd命令来改变当前目录。例如,如果文件位于D盘的“文档”文件夹中,可以使用以下命令:
cd D:\文档
步骤三:使用type命令查看文件内容
在定位到文件所在目录后,我们可以使用type命令来查看文件内容。例如,如果文件名为“example.txt”,可以使用以下命令:
type example.txt
这将显示文件的全部内容。
步骤四:使用findstr命令定位特定位置的字符
为了定位到第二行第二列的字符,我们可以使用findstr命令。findstr命令可以用于在文件中搜索特定的字符串。下面是一个示例命令,它将定位到第二行第二列的字符:
type example.txt | findstr "^(.{1}).{1}.*$"
这个命令的原理如下:
^(.{1}).{1}.*$:这是一个正则表达式,用于匹配每一行的第二列字符。^:表示行的开始。.{1}:匹配任意字符一次。.*$:匹配任意字符,直到行的结束。
通过这个命令,我们可以找到文件中第二行第二列的字符。
步骤五:处理结果
执行上述命令后,CMD将输出文件中第二行第二列的字符。如果文件中不存在第二行第二列的字符,则不会输出任何内容。
总结
通过以上步骤,我们可以使用CMD读取文件特定位置的字符。这种方法简单易行,适用于Windows系统。在实际应用中,我们可以根据需要修改正则表达式,以匹配不同的字符位置。
